Rahul Gandhi Begins Two-Day Visit to Maharashtra
The Congress leader will unveil a statue of Chhatrapati Shivaji Maharaj and participate in a Constitution conference in Kolhapur.
- Rahul Gandhi's visit to Kolhapur is part of his campaign efforts ahead of Maharashtra's Assembly elections.
- The visit includes the unveiling of a 20-foot statue of Chhatrapati Shivaji Maharaj, designed with historical accuracy.
- Gandhi will also pay homage to the memorial of Rajarshi Shahu Maharaj, a key figure in Maharashtra's social reform movement.
- A Samvidhan Sammelan, focused on the Indian Constitution, will be held with participation from thousands of attendees.
- Prominent Congress leaders, including former Chief Ministers and party officials, will join Gandhi during the two-day event.
